The 13th Moscow International Military Song Festival ‘Vivat Pobeda’ (Vivat Victory)

On the 30th of April and the 1st of May in Zelenograd culture centre the 13th Moscow International Military Song Festival ‘Vivat Pobeda’ (Vivat Victory) took place. Traditionally it is devoted to the victory in the Great Patriotic War, but this year it was also coincided with the 200th anniversary of victory in the Patriotic War of 1812.

This year more than 100 participants from Moscow, Moscow region and other Russian regions as well as Armenia,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Tajikistan, Kirghizia and Ukraine took part in the festival.

The co-founders of the event are Zelenograd prefect, Department of Culture of Moscow, Department of Family and Youth Policy of Moscow, Committee of Public Relations of Moscow,

Blagovest Centre of People’s Aid. The festival is also supported by Bureau of Educational Work of the Armed Forces of the Russian Federation and Secretariat of the Council of the Defense Ministers of the CIS countries.

The competitive programme was held on the 30th of April, and on the 1st of May the award ceremony and the gala concert took place.
